Learn How to Promote a Pawn: Crushing Endgame
This chess endgame is a classic example of using a passed pawn as the main winning asset. White’s advanced pawn is close to promotion, but the key is that it cannot simply run forward without support. The winning idea is to force the defender’s pieces into awkward squares, then use tactical attraction to remove the last blocker. In classical chess, these positions often look material-heavy, but the passer and king activity decide everything.
